McMULLEN v. STATE

Court of Appeals No. A-12955.

426 P.3d 1168 (2018)

Daniel Matthew McMULLEN, Appellant, v. STATE of Alaska, Appellee.

Court of Appeals of Alaska.

July 27, 2018.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Windy Hannaman (initial brief) and Renee McFarland (supplemental brief), Assistant Public Defenders, and Quinlan Steiner , Public Defender, Anchorage, for the Appellant.

Donald Soderstrom , Assistant Attorney General, Office of Criminal Appeals, Anchorage, and Jahna Lindemuth , Attorney General, Juneau, for the Appellee.

Before: Mannheimer, Chief Judge, and Allard and Wollenberg, Judges.


OPINION

Daniel Matthew McMullen appeals the denial of his judicial peremptory challenge.1 Under Alaska Criminal Rule 25(d), the prosecution and the defense in a criminal case are each entitled to one change of judge as a matter of right. In this case, the court denied McMullen's challenge...
